Birrell family tree » John Grieve (1728-????)

Personal data John Grieve 

Source 1Sources 2, 3
  • He was born Aug 11 1728 in Tushalaw, Ettrick, Roxburoughshire Scotland.
  • He was baptized on August 11, 1728 in Ettrick, Selkirk, Scotland.Source 2

Household of John Grieve

He is married to Elizabeth Alexander Paisley.

They got married on June 12, 1767 at Castleton,Roxburgh,Scotland, he was 39 years old.Source 3


Child(ren):

  1. Margaret Grieve  1768-????
  2. Mary Grieve  1769-????
  3. Elizabeth Grieve  1770-????
  4. Jean Grieve  1771-1833 
  5. Walter Grieve  1772-???? 
  6. Jennet Grieve  1774-???? 
  7. James Grieve  1774-????
  8. William Grieve  1777-1824 
  9. John Grieve  1782-1850 
  10. Elliot Grieve  1784-1871
